73WCrMoV2-2 Tool Die Steels

73WCrMoV2-2 - Specification & Application

Alloyed VCrMoW steel

Chemical composition(wt.%) of 73WCrMoV2-2 grade:

Elements Min.(≥) Max.(≤) Similar Remarks
C 0.68 0.78
Si 0.20 0.40
Mn 0.40 0.60
P - 0.035
S - 0.035
Cr 0.40 0.60
Mo 0.25 0.40
V 0.15 0.30
W 0.40 0.70
